Silver City, New Mexico vs. Helena, Montana

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Helena, Montana is 27.8% more expensive than Silver City, New Mexico.

You would need a salary of $63,882 in Helena, Montana to maintain the standard of living you have in Silver City, New Mexico.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Helena, Montana is more expensive than Silver City, New Mexico
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
102% more expensive in Helena
than in Silver City, New Mexico
